Hype for the Future 184J: City of Plattsmouth, Nebraska
Overview The City of Plattsmouth is the county seat of Cass County, Nebraska, located along the Missouri River at the mouth of the Platte River. Hype for the Future 184C: Gage County, Nebraska
Overview Located in the southeastern portion of the State of Nebraska is Gage County, which uses the City of Beatrice as the county seat. The county is located along Routes 77 and 136, as well as N-8 to the south, N-112 to the southwest, and N-4 in the vicinity. At the northern end of the county are N-41, N-43, and N-34B. Hype for the Future 183N: Clay County, Nebraska
Overview Within the eastern portion of the State of Nebraska, immediately east of Hastings and Adams County, is Clay County, which uses Clay Center as the county seat and is principally located along Route 6, N-14, N-18E, N-41, and N-74.
